HIGH FUNCTIONAL CARBON/CARBON COMPOSITE HAVING HIGH CARBON FIBER CONTRIBUTION RATIO

摘要

PROBLEM TO BE SOLVED: To provide a high functional carbon/carbon composite material high in breakage strain energy of a manufactured carbon/carbon composite material and low in material anisotropy.;SOLUTION: There is provided a carbon/carbon composite material which contains a continuous carbon fiber tow or a short fiber carbon fiber as a reinforced fiber and petroleum and/or coal-based binder pitch powder having softening resistance and petroleum and/or coal-based coke powder having no softening resistance as starting materials of a matrix component and has a constitution with volume percentage content of the reinforced fiber of 15% to 25% and a ratio of a heat conductivity KL in a fiber direction of the carbon/carbon composite material and heat conductivity KT in a direction with a right angle with the fiber direction, KT/KL of 0.5.;SELECTED DRAWING: None;COPYRIGHT: (C)2017,JPO&INPIT
